Hypebeast blog roll contributer and The Award Tour founder, Phillip T. Annand is featured in this new video from Street Talk. Amongst other subjects, the intriguing creative speaks of his brand, The Award Tour, inspiration for starting a clothing line, and of his upcoming editorial project, The Madbury Club. Definitely a good look into the mind of a worthy up-and-comer. Enjoy!
